Depending on the company, you may be able to remove someone from your car insurance policy online or through an app. Some insurers may require you to contact a representative to remove a driver and provide proof that the driver no longer lives with you. Since companies may vary as to the exact process, check with your insurer for more details. Removing someone from your car insurance policy may lower your overall rate, but it depends on several factors related to that individual driver. You can remove a listed driver from your insurance policy if they no longer live with you and no longer drive your vehicle.
